Various formats of using educational digital products: a case study of National University of Oil and Gas "Gubkin University"

Annotation:

The authors of the article consider the use of digital products as a learning tool of higher education, using "Gubkin University" as an example. Three original formats for developing and utilizing educational digital products are discussed. The first format involves the development of simplified educational applications by students of the Faculty of Automation and Computer Engineering as part of their coursework or diploma projects. Within this format, senior students can develop interactive demonstration materials for junior students, which is particularly relevant for specialized industry-focused universities. The second format involves the development of virtual laboratory works based on professional software products designed for automating industrial processes, such as PI System. A significant advantage of this format lies in the fact that the developer of the laboratory work does not require specialized programming skills. However, the educational process becomes tied to the software provider. The third format involves development of digital simulators for laboratory works. The digital simulator is developed as an application for desktop and mobile devices, following the recommendations and requirements of a specific university tutor. It includes built-in instructions and a function to verify students’ actions. This format is the most oriented toward distance learning compared to the others.
